If you are purchasing a new motor, the following limits would apply to a test rigidly mounted (NEMA MG-1).
< 1 mil (most limiting for frequencies < 1200cpm)
< 0.12ips (most limiting for frequencies 1200-24,000cpm)
< 0.18 g's. (most limiting for frequencies >24,000)
Which one is most limiting depends upon what frequency range the energy is in.
I think that those are pretty tight limits to apply to all in-service machines. I know you already know it but.... look at historical performance AND performance of sister machines.
